Ok... Its in my 70 duster, its got a pretty warmed up 360, 10:1, big cam, no vacuum
727, 2400stall, 3.55 gear...U kno...lol
The carb is a quick fuel race carb with annuler boosters, 4 corner idle
Im tryin to lean out the cruz a/f on the wideband
Shud i be increasing all 4 corners idle air bleed, or mainly just up front
I got the idle a/f dialed in, jus when im cruzin 1500-2000rpm

Im thinkin jus up front shud do it... But what you guys say??

Oh ya, its Progressive linkage.... So im only tippin in up front when cruzin
Thats why im thinkin jus mess with air bleeds up front, and dont worry about the back
At least for this rich cruz thing im tryin to lean out
 
Wudnt u wanna go larger idle jet? That wud get more air in and lean out that circut right??

Think he means ifr`s.............idle feed restrictors which some call "idle jets" and those will lean out the supplied fuel to the idle circuit but I`d go .005 bigger on all four idle bleeds and go from there.
